What Is the Job of a Remote Developer?

Remote developers, or remote software developers, design and create computer software programs and applications for their employer or client. Unlike in-house developers, remote developers work from home or another location outside of the office. As a remote developer, you discuss the kind of program you need to create, making sure to clarify with your department or with your client what they need in their application. You may develop an entirely new program or improve an existing one. Remote developers are responsible for a program’s overall function, and they design precise workflow charts that explain to programmers what code is needed for different aspects of the program. Remote developers may also design tests and protocols for the QA department to follow when they are testing the application.

What are the key skills and qualifications needed to thrive as a Remote Developer, and why are they important?

To thrive as a Remote Developer, you need strong programming skills, problem-solving abilities, and experience with software development methodologies, often supported by a relevant degree or coding certifications. Familiarity with version control systems like Git, remote collaboration tools (e.g., Slack, Jira), and cloud-based development environments is typically required. Excellent self-motivation, time management, and clear written communication set standout remote developers apart. These skills and qualities are crucial for delivering high-quality code, collaborating effectively across distributed teams, and maintaining productivity independently.

What are some common challenges faced by remote developers, and how can they be managed effectively?

Remote developers often encounter challenges such as communication barriers, feelings of isolation, and managing work-life balance due to the lack of physical boundaries between home and work. To overcome these, it's important to establish clear communication channels with your team, set regular check-ins, and use collaboration tools effectively. Additionally, creating a dedicated workspace and setting defined work hours can help maintain productivity and personal well-being. Many companies also support remote developers through virtual team-building activities and flexible schedules.

POSITION OVERVIEW:

The Security Engineer (SIEM & IDS/IPS Administrator) is responsible for the endtoend administration, maintenance, and optimization of the organization’s onpremise Security Information and Event Management (SIEM) platform and Intrusion Detection/Prevention Systems (IDS/IPS). This role ensures that these critical security technologies remain highly available, strategically aligned with enterprise security objectives, governed according to policy, and operating at peak effectiveness.

The engineer will work closely with cybersecurity, infrastructure, and governance teams to ensure that threat detection, alerting, and response capabilities are robust, reliable, and continuously improving.

This is a full time, exempt position.

IN THIS ROLE, YOU WILL:   

SIEM Administration & Engineering

  • Manage, maintain, and optimize the onpremise SIEM platform, including log ingestion, parsing, correlation rules, dashboards, and alerting.
  • Ensure SIEM availability, performance, and scalability to support enterprise security monitoring needs.
  • Develop and tune detection rules, correlation logic, and use cases aligned with threat intelligence and organizational risk.
  • Oversee log source onboarding, configuration, and validation across servers, applications, network devices, and security tools.
  • Conduct regular SIEM health checks, capacity planning, and lifecycle management.

IDS/IPS Administration & Engineering

  • Administer and maintain onpremise IDS/IPS platforms, ensuring accurate detection and prevention of malicious activity.
  • Tune signatures, policies, and rulesets to reduce false positives while maintaining strong detection coverage.
  • Monitor IDS/IPS performance, availability, and event trends to identify anomalies or operational issues.
  • Coordinate with network and security teams to implement policy updates, rule changes, and architectural improvements.

Operational Excellence & Governance

  • Ensure both SIEM and IDS/IPS solutions are aligned with security governance frameworks, compliance requirements, and organizational policies.
  • Maintain documentation for system configurations, processes, runbooks, and governance controls.
  • Support audit activities by providing evidence, reports, and system configuration details.
  • Participate in incident response activities by providing SIEM/IDS/IPS insights, event analysis, and technical expertise.

Strategic Alignment & Continuous Improvement

  • Evaluate emerging threats and recommend enhancements to detection logic and monitoring capabilities.
  • Collaborate with architecture and leadership teams to align SIEM and IDS/IPS strategies with longterm security objectives.
  • Identify opportunities to automate processes, improve detection fidelity, and enhance operational efficiency.
